A nice morning to be outside doing research. Five new species for the season were American Goldfinch, Sharp-shinned Hawk, Black-headed Grosbeak, Green Towhee, and Dusky Flycatcher.
*28 New Birds Banded * Orange-crowned Warbler - 6 Audubon's (Yellow-rumped) Warbler -1 Myrtle (Yellow-rumped) Warbler - 2 Dusky Flycatcher -1 House Wren -1 Hermit Thrush -1 American Goldfinch - 5 Chipping Sparrow - 2 Gambel's White-crowned Sparrow - 2 Spotted Towhee- 3 Green Towhee -1 Summer Tanager -1 Gray Catbird -1 Black-headed Grosbeak -1 Sharp-shinned Hawk -1 Recapture American Robin -1 (Returning bird from previous years) We'll be open 6 days a week through May 27th, closed on Sundays (with the exception of being open on May 15th and closed on May 16th).
